Colorado Legends and Legacies Youth Corps' Philosophy: The Colorado Legends and Legacies Youth Corps (CLLYC) provides young men and women a youth corps experience. Crewmembers serve in a team-oriented, labor-intensive work environment and develop both personally and professionally. The CLLYC program is designed to offer transferable employment skills and exposure to natural resources and parks and recreation careers. Corpsmembers also have the opportunity to enhance their leadership, group working, and life skills as well as learn to become stewards of Colorado's natural resources.

Program Overview: Crew will perform assessments of energy use and install energy saving devices such as programmable thermostats, low-flow showerheads, compact fluorescent light bulbs, and CO/Smoke detectors in LEAP (low-income energy assistance program) eligible homes in Colorado Springs and El Paso County. Crewmembers will also educate the home occupants on ways to save energy and teach them how to adjust and monitor temperatures on major home appliances.
